1. Animal feed in dairy farming typically consists of roughages (such as hay or silage) for fiber, concentrates (like grains and protein supplements) for energy and protein, vitamins, and minerals. A balanced blend ensures optimal nutrition for milk production and cow health.

  2. Dairy animal nutrition must fulfill milk production requirements by providing sufficient energy, protein, vitamins, and minerals. A balanced diet supports lactation, promoting high milk yields, while maintaining cow health and reproductive efficiency for sustainable dairy farming operations.
